Artists Statement

Patricia Brennan

I was born in 1961 in the town of Ardee, County Louth, Ireland where I still live. Although I Love to travel there is nothing I like more to do than to draw and paint in my studio. I studied for a diploma with the London Art College and I am registered with the Craft Council of Ireland. My inspiration would come from nature and would have an Irish influence. I have exhibited at various venues using a variety of media and my ambitions are that the viewer gets as much enjoyment out of my paintings as I did when I painted them. Happy viewing.

Medium: Oils and watercolour.

Painting on left: Stone Cottage is a watercolour and 10"x12.5"in size. It is framed and costs €40.

Painting in centre: The old Bike is Watercolour and 10"x10" in size. It is framed and costs €40.

Painting on right: Greenfinch is done in oils and is 16.5"x14" in size. It is framed and costs €60.
